Java Developer Resume
St Louis, MO
SUMMARY
- 7 - year IT Industry experiences with a focus on all phases of Software Development Life Cycle (SDLC), extensive experiences and knowledge of Java / J2EE Development, Oracle PL/SQL & database Development and Web
- 7-year IT experiences with Java Web development, Oracle Web database development
- 5-year Java / J2EE development experiences with Core Java, Struts, JSP, Servlet, Spring, Hibernate, JUnit Testing, Ant and Maven
- 7-year Oracle development experiences with pl/sql web toolkits, performance tuning, data loading and database objects management
- 5-year Web UI development experiences with HTML / HTML5, CSS / CSS3, Javascript, JQuery, Json, Ajax, XML, XSLT
- Strong working knowledge and experiences in Spring MVC, Hibernate and Restful Web Service
- Proficiency in Shell scripting development with Oracle report generating and Crontab job scheduling in Unix/Linux environment
- Ability to work both independently and in various team settings
- Ability to work under pressure with a solid sense for setting priorities
- Ability to manage own learning and contribute to domain knowledge building
TECHNICAL SKILLS
Languages: Java, Servlet, JSP, JSF, HTML, CSS, X XSLT, Javascript, JQuery, Json, Ajax, SQL, PL/SQL, UNIX Korn Shell Scripting, PHP, ASP, C#, .Net, RESTful, SOAP
OS: Windows 2003 / XP / 7, Linux Solaris OS / Cent OS
Databases: Oracle 9/10/11, MySQL, PostgreSQL, SQL Server 2005
Dev Tool: Eclipse IDE, RAD 7.0, Toad, PL/SQL Developer, SQL Developer, Aptana Studio, Firebugs,Oracle Apex, Oracle Portal, Oracle Form/Report, ClearCase/ClearQuest, SVN, PVCS, HPQCVersionOne and Autosys
PROFESSIONAL EXPERIENCE
Confidential, St Louis, MO
Java Developer
Responsibilities:
- Developed and integrated with new web reporting functionalities for existing apps to generate new reports in PDF Format and EXCEL Format on Struts / Spring framework.
- Developed new widget to populate dynamic news messages with Restful web service for existing app
- Developed and performed unit testing scripts with JUnit API and PowerMock API in TDD environments.
- Working in Agile/Scrum Development Methodology environment
Environment: Java 1.6, Struts 1.3/2.0, Spring Framework 2.0, Log4J/JUnit/PowerMock/iText/Poi API, RESTful Web Service, RAD 8.0/Eclipse, WAS 7.0, SVN, Oracle 11g, SQL Developer, DB2, IBM DB2 Command Editor, VERSIONONE
Confidential, Tempe, AZ
Web Developer
Responsibilities:
- Developed new web pages, functionalities and work flows for both front-end and back-end using JQuery, Json, Ajax, Javascript, HTML, CSS, XML, XSLT, PL/SQL Web Toolkits, tables, views, triggers, packages, procedures, functions, sequences, types, objects and synonym.
- Migrated existing web pages, functionalities and work flows and Oracle database objects from Atlas website to Clarity website.
- Collaborated in the design of program logic with BA to implement required functions.
- Developed and performed unit test plans, functional test plans and regression test plans.
- Prepared and assisted in the preparation of code review, design doc review, test plan review and deploying scripts review.
- Coordinated with QC team to troubleshoot and fix all kinds of problems.
- Working in Scrum Development Methodology environment
Environment: Aptana Studio, Firebugs, SQL Developer, HPQC, SVN, HTML, CSS, XML, XSLT, Javascript, Jquery, Json, Ajax, PL/SQL Web Toolkit, Oracle App Server, Oracle 10 /11g database
Confidential, Orlando, Florida
Java Developer
Responsibilities:
- Developed new and enhanced existing web pages, functionalities and work flows for both front-end and back-end with Java, Struts, Servlet, JSP, JQuery, Json, Ajax, Javascript, HTML, XML, CSS, pl/sql Web Toolkits, schema objects
- Developed Oracle query scripts for DAO.
- Developed and performed unit testing scripts with JUnit API in TDD environments.
- Deployed Apps to Tomcat Application Server.
- Performed PL/SQL query tuning, analyze execution plans and create new test-run for indexes and optimizer hints
Environment: Java 1.6, Struts 1.3/2.0, Log4J/JUnit, /Eclipse, SOAP, Tomcat, PVCS, PL/SQL Developer, Aptana Studio, Firebugs, HITOUCH, HTML, CSS, XML, XSLT, Javascript, Jquery, Json, Ajax, PL/SQL Web Toolkit, Oracle 9i/10g/11g database
Confidential, New York
Java Developer
Responsibilities:
- Developed new and enhanced existing functions with Java, Struts, JSP, Servlet, pl/sql scripting
- Developed job scheduling scripts to generate daily/weekly/monthly reports with Crontab in Unix
- Managed database schema objects and performed pl/sql query tuning, analyze execution plans and conduct test-run for optimizer hints in Oracle database
- Provided Production Support, troubleshooting and fix bugs for Java Web Apps and Oracle Database
Environment: Java 1.6, Struts 1.3/2.0, Log4J/JUnit, SOAP, Eclipse, Tomcat, CVS, SQL Developer, HTML, CSS, XML, XSLT, Javascript, Jquery, Json, Ajax, PL/SQL Web Toolkit, Oracle 9i/10g/11g database
Confidential, New York
Application Developer
Responsibilities:
- Developed and maintained multiple Java Web Apps & Oracle Web Apps using Java, Struts, Servlet, JSP, pl/sql web toolkit, HTP, HTF and OWA packages, HTML, CSS and Javascript, XML, Oracle Portal and Oracle Apex, Java Apps, Oracle Forms 10gi, Oracle Reports 10g, Crystal Reports and Access
- Managed Oracle Database Objects and performance tuning under the direction of DBA
- Provide Production Support in Unix/Linux environment for eBear Portal and Oracle database.
Environment: Dreamweaver, Firebugs, SQL Developer, Java 1.5, Struts, Servlet, JSP, HTML, CSS, XML, XSLT, Javascript, Jquery, Json, Ajax, PL/SQL Web Toolkit, Oracle App Server, Oracle 10 /11g database
Confidential, Hanover, Maryland
Java Developer
Responsibilities:
- Developed new release R3B2 of CHART using core Java, pl/sql scripts and t-sql scripts
- Deployed the new release R3B2 of CHART to Tomcat using ANT Build Scripts
Environment: Java 1.5, Log4J/JUnit, Eclipse, Tomcat, ClearCase/ClearQuest, SQL Developer, PL/SQL, Oracle 9i/10g/11g database, T-SQL, SQL Server 2005